DTC CONFIRMATION PROCEDURE
1.
PERFORM DTC CONFIRMATION PROCEDURE
1.
Start engine.
2.
Drive vehicle at a speed of 4 km/h (2.5 MPH) or more for 10 seconds or more.
3.
Check DTC in “Self Diagnostic Result” mode of “BCM” using CONSULT-III.
Is DTC detected?
YES
>> Go to
NO
>> INSPECTION END

DTC No.
Trouble diagnosis name
DTC detecting condition
Possible cause
B2602
SHIFT POSITION
BCM detects the following status for 10 seconds.
• Selector lever is in the P position
• Vehicle speed is 4 km/h (2.5 MPH) or more
• Ignition switch is in the ON position
• Harness or connectors
(CAN communication line is open or
shorted.)
• Harness or connectors
[A/T shift selector (detention switch)
circuit is open or shorted.]
• A/T shift selector (detention switch)
• Combination meter
• BCM
